Our Evaluation FrameworkThe Pillars of Patient Safety

We believe that true quality is multidimensional. A hospital may have a beautiful lobby, but what truly matters are its clinical outcomes, the expertise of its staff, and its unwavering commitment to patient-centered care. Our framework is designed to assess every facet of a healthcare provider's operations. Here are the core criteria we meticulously evaluate:

1.

Clinical Success Rates & Verifiable Outcomes

Why it matters: A facility's track record is the most powerful indicator of its capabilities. We look beyond marketing claims to analyze verifiable data on treatment success rates, patient-reported outcomes, and, just as importantly, complication and revision rates. This data-driven approach ensures that the hospitals in our network consistently deliver positive results for procedures relevant to your needs.

2.

International Certifications & Quality Awards

Why it matters: While we maintain our own proprietary standards, we view international accreditations like Joint Commission International (JCI) and ISO certifications as crucial baseline indicators. These awards demonstrate a facility's commitment to implementing and upholding global best practices in areas like infection control, clinical governance, and patient safety protocols. They signal a culture of continuous improvement and external validation.

Our Methodology

A Dynamic & Rigorous Approach

Our evaluation is not a one-time event. It is a continuous, cyclical process designed to ensure our standards are not just met, but consistently maintained

The SafeMedigo Evaluation Cycle

Our methodology is built on a foundation of annual audits and continuous monitoring. While each criterion in our framework is critical, our weighting system places the highest emphasis on verifiable clinical outcomes and patient safety protocols. We believe these two areas are the most direct measures of the quality of care you will receive.

01

Annual Comprehensive Audit

Every facility in our network undergoes a formal, in-depth review each year. This involves a re-verification of all credentials, an analysis of the latest clinical data, and an on-site inspection where necessary.

02

Continuous Patient Feedback Loop

After their treatment, we actively solicit detailed feedback from every SafeMedigo patient. This real-time data is immediately used to address any concerns and is a key factor in a facility's ongoing rating within our network.

03

Quarterly Performance Review

We review key metrics, including patient feedback trends and publicly available data, on a quarterly basis to catch any emerging issues long before they become significant problems.
